很多打算转行学习UI设计的新手小白们,都卡在了学习UI设计上,很多人跟小编说:学习UI设计真的太难了,零基础根本就是学不会,怎么办呢? 很多人都是学到一半,就选择了放弃。那么,零基础的小伙伴们,学不会的时候也要放弃吗? 1、就是去读一些编程方面的书。我特别建议你,当你想去做一些 Android 或者是 iOS 设计的时候,你就去找一两本这方面的书,把它们翻一遍或者很快速地去看一遍,然后你就会知道有哪些控件、方式和基本的常识。这个过程很快就能结束,我们以前都有这样做过。 2、就是去看大量的产品,去看看现在的产品都已经实现了什么样的功能或效果。其实当前在技术层面上和 UI 相关的地方基本上没有特别多的难点,所以只要你去看看在别的软件里的效果都有哪些,它们又是如何被实现的,看得多了以后你就会发现 3、同理,这些东西在我的设计里是可以实现的,或者说是很快可以做出来的。这也是一种很好的方式去了解并拓展“技术的可行性边界”,去了解哪些东西可以做,哪些东西还不能做。 4、除此之外还有一个很重要的方面,就是你在做具体的一些设计的时候和开发团队之间的配合问题。因为你做的每一点设计在去具体实现的时候对技术都有相关的不同需求,所以这个时候在工作中就要去和工程师进行特别深入和紧密的交流。 5、尤其是你在做交互或者产品设计相关的工作的时候,你需要不断地去和工程师沟通,去了解你的设计或想法到底能不能实现。如果不可以做的话,你就需要知道难点在哪里,怎么样才能使它变得可行。 6、这样日积月累之后,你发现自己逐渐对技术有了很多了解,你可以不会写代码,但是你了解的东西会越来越多,这对你知识的沉淀是很有好处的。在这个方面里还有一个需要注意的地方,就是要多问问题 7、而且是问有技术含量的问题,因为简单的一些问题通过看书都是可以很快补起来的,而只有一些和领域、业务、代码、具体项目等紧密相关的问题才是需要你去穷追猛打并不耻下问的。 8、对于代码你可以不学习,但是Z好是可以去了解一下!因为你的作品不能只是炫,也得给搞前端的考虑考虑,你的作品到底能不能实现,做什么效果实现起来简单又有个性,否则你做一堆东西却实现不了那都没用,所以,多了解一些这方面的知识肯定是有好处的! 9、其实一个企业真正需要的是,能真正能做好设计的设计师,能写好代码的开发者,并且设计师和开发者能够无缝地协作。设计师会不会代码其实没有关心,但是设计师需要了解开发了解代码的工作流程和原理,这样能与开发人员进行良好的沟通,让工作事半功倍。